Step-by-Step Means of Performing a Free Rider Soar

Executing a free rider leap is a posh maneuver, demanding exact coordination and timing. The method could be damaged down into distinct phases, every essential for a profitable end result. Neglecting any of those steps can result in a less-than-ideal leap, or worse, a crash.The method part begins nicely earlier than the leap’s lip. The rider ought to keep a constant pace, ideally chosen based mostly on the leap’s dimension and form.

A great method permits for constant momentum. As you method the leap, the rider’s physique place ought to be low and centered over the bike, with the elbows bent and relaxed, prepared to soak up any bumps or imperfections within the terrain. The eyes ought to be centered on the touchdown, not the leap itself.The takeoff part is the place the bike leaves the bottom.

Simply earlier than hitting the lip, the rider ought to “preload” the suspension by compressing the bike – bending the knees and dropping the physique barely. This preloading motion, mixed with a fast extension because the entrance wheel hits the lip, gives the carry wanted for the leap. It is important to take care of a balanced place, conserving the load centered over the bike.Within the air, changes are typically crucial.

The rider’s physique place might be key. If the rider feels the bike is rotating an excessive amount of, refined shifts in weight can right the trajectory. For instance, leaning barely ahead may also help convey the entrance finish down, whereas leaning again will convey the entrance find yourself. The rider ought to maintain their eyes centered on the touchdown.The touchdown part is arguably essentially the most vital.

Because the bike nears the touchdown, the rider ought to put together to soak up the influence. This entails bending the knees and elbows, successfully performing as shock absorbers. The rider’s weight ought to be centered over the bike, with the physique relaxed however in management. Intention for a easy, managed touchdown, distributing the influence throughout each wheels.

Sustaining constant pace, preloading the suspension, balancing within the air, and absorbing the influence upon touchdown are essential to success.

Frequent Errors and Options for Learners

Learners usually encounter particular challenges when studying free rider jumps. Recognizing these frequent errors and implementing corrective actions can considerably speed up the educational course of and scale back the danger of damage.* Inadequate Velocity: Many learners method jumps too slowly, leading to a brief, flat leap. The answer is to observe approaches, progressively rising pace till the leap feels snug and the rider clears the meant distance.

Poor Physique Place

An incorrect physique place can throw off the stability and management. This contains leaning too far ahead or backward, or not preloading the suspension successfully. The treatment is to give attention to sustaining a centered, balanced place all through the complete leap, together with bending the knees and elbows.

Trying Down

Trying down on the leap lip or the bike can disrupt the rider’s stability and timing. The answer is to maintain the eyes centered on the touchdown all through the complete leap.

Not Absorbing the Influence

Failing to soak up the influence upon touchdown can result in a harsh touchdown and potential damage. The rider ought to bend their knees and elbows to behave as shock absorbers upon touchdown.

Evaluating Follow Places: Grime Jumps, Skate Parks, and City Environments

The optimum location for training free rider jumps relies upon closely on the rider’s ability degree and the particular objectives of the coaching session. Every sort of setting – filth jumps, skate parks, and concrete environments – presents distinctive benefits and downsides. Grime Jumps: Grime jumps are particularly designed for riders to observe jumps and aerial maneuvers.* Advantages: They provide purpose-built options, together with various shapes and sizes of jumps, designed to accommodate completely different ability ranges.

The surfaces are usually well-maintained, offering constant roll-in and touchdown circumstances. The managed setting minimizes the presence of surprising obstacles, permitting riders to give attention to their approach. The power to form and modify the jumps to fulfill particular coaching wants is a big benefit.

Drawbacks

Grime jumps might not at all times be readily accessible, requiring journey or membership charges. The necessity for normal upkeep can result in closures or restricted availability. The training curve could be steep for learners, as mastering the essential strategies is important earlier than making an attempt extra complicated jumps. Skate Parks: Skate parks present a various vary of options, together with ramps, bowls, and rails, that can be utilized for training jumps and creating aerial abilities.* Advantages: Skate parks provide a managed setting with easy surfaces and predictable transitions.

The number of options permits riders to develop a variety of abilities, together with leaping, grinding, and carving. They’re usually open to the general public, making them simply accessible.

Drawbacks

Skate parks will not be particularly designed for bikes, so some options may not be best free of charge rider jumps. The presence of different customers, reminiscent of skate boarders and scooter riders, can create potential conflicts and security hazards. The transitions will not be as forgiving as these discovered on filth jumps, rising the danger of falls. City Environments: City environments provide a novel set of challenges and alternatives free of charge rider jumps.* Advantages: They supply entry to all kinds of pure and man-made options, reminiscent of stairs, ledges, and gaps.

They provide the potential for artistic and modern driving types. The accessibility of city environments makes them a handy choice for riders dwelling in cities.

Drawbacks

City environments usually current important security hazards, together with site visitors, pedestrians, and unpredictable obstacles. The surfaces could also be uneven or slippery, rising the danger of falls. The legality of driving in city environments could be questionable, resulting in potential confrontations with authorities. The dearth of a managed setting makes it troublesome to evaluate and mitigate dangers.

Historic Origins and Emergence inside Biking Tradition

Free rider jumps did not spring into existence in a single day; they advanced from the need to beat obstacles and the innate human drive to check limits. Early biking, notably within the late nineteenth and early twentieth centuries, centered totally on street racing and observe biking. Nevertheless, the emergence of mountain biking within the Seventies and 80s supplied a brand new canvas for riders to discover off-road terrain.

The inherent challenges of navigating trails, together with uneven surfaces, pure jumps, and drop-offs, naturally led to the event of strategies for overcoming these obstacles. This evolution was not solely about pace; it was concerning the thrill of the trip and the flexibility to beat difficult environments. The roots of free rider jumps are deeply embedded within the spirit of journey that characterizes mountain biking.Early examples of what would change into free rider jumps had been rudimentary at finest, usually involving merely launching over small rises within the terrain or makeshift ramps constructed from wooden or earth.

These preliminary makes an attempt had been much less about type and extra about survival, as riders centered on navigating the obstacles and sustaining management. The emphasis on conquering difficult terrain was key to the early growth of free rider jumps. As mountain biking gained reputation, so did the ambition of the riders, and the need to push the boundaries of what was achievable on a motorbike.

Influential Riders and Pioneers Who Formed the Sport

The historical past of free rider jumps is stuffed with legendary figures who pushed the boundaries of what was thought potential. These pioneers not solely perfected the strategies but additionally impressed generations of riders to comply with of their tire tracks. Their contributions had been multifaceted, encompassing not simply driving ability but additionally tools innovation and the cultivation of the free rider tradition.

  • Shaun Palmer: Typically cited as a key determine within the early days of freeriding, Palmer’s aggressive type and willingness to sort out any terrain set a brand new normal. He was a multi-sport athlete who introduced a degree of athleticism and aptitude to mountain biking that had not been seen earlier than.
  • Richie Schley: Generally known as one of many “godfathers of freeride,” Schley’s easy type and skill to trip technical trails with grace and precision helped outline the game. His give attention to move and creativity impressed many riders.
  • Wade Simmons: Simmons is credited with pioneering most of the early freeride methods. He showcased a method that blended technical ability with an unparalleled sense of favor and creativity.
  • Darren Berrecloth: Berrecloth’s influence is critical because of his involvement in competitions like Crimson Bull Rampage. He helped push the boundaries of what was potential by way of leap dimension and trick issue.

These riders, and lots of others, helped form the game by demonstrating that free rider jumps had been greater than only a strategy to overcome obstacles; they had been an artwork kind. Their modern strategies and relentless pursuit of excellence have impressed numerous riders and proceed to affect the game at the moment. Their legacies are seen within the evolution of methods, tools, and the general aesthetic of free rider jumps.

Timeline Showcasing the Evolution of Soar Kinds and Tools, Free rider jumps

The evolution of free rider jumps has been marked by steady innovation in each approach and tools. The next timeline Artikels some key milestones:

  1. Seventies-Nineteen Eighties: The genesis of mountain biking and early experimentation with off-road jumps. Riders make the most of pure terrain and assemble primary wood ramps. The bikes are heavy, inflexible, and lack suspension.
  2. Early Nineties: The introduction of entrance suspension forks begins to enhance the trip high quality and allow riders to sort out tougher terrain. Primary jumps change into extra frequent, with riders studying to regulate their bikes within the air.
  3. Mid-to-Late Nineties: Full-suspension mountain bikes start to emerge, revolutionizing the game. This technological development permits riders to sort out larger jumps and land with extra management. The main target shifts in direction of larger jumps and extra complicated methods.
  4. Early 2000s: The rise of devoted freeride bikes, with longer journey suspension and extra sturdy parts. The introduction of occasions just like the Crimson Bull Rampage pushes the boundaries of leap dimension and trick issue.
  5. Mid-2000s to Current: Continued refinement of motorbike design, with developments in body geometry, suspension know-how, and part sturdiness. The event of latest methods and types, together with slopestyle and filth leaping, additional expands the probabilities of free rider jumps. Riders are pushing the boundaries of what’s potential, creating ever extra spectacular feats of ability and daring.

The timeline displays a steady cycle of innovation, the place developments in tools and approach feed one another, leading to an ongoing evolution of the game.
